The US government has officially pivoted its artificial intelligence strategy, prioritizing rapid commercial innovation and defensive cybersecurity over preemptive safety regulations. Executive Order 14409, titled "Promoting Advanced Artificial Intelligence Innovation and Security," establishes a new federal framework designed to maintain American dominance in the global tech race. Rather than imposing strict mandates, the directive relies on public-private collaboration to harden critical infrastructure against AI-enabled threats.
At the center of this policy shift is a voluntary review mechanism for the industry's most powerful systems, known as frontier models. Under the new framework, AI developers are encouraged to grant federal agencies—including the Treasury Department, the Cybersecurity and Infrastructure Security Agency (CISA), and the National Security Agency (NSA)—early access to their models. This allows the government a 30-day window to test the systems for cybersecurity vulnerabilities before they are released to trusted partners or the broader public.[1][2]
To support this review process, the executive order mandates the creation of a classified benchmarking system within 60 days. This system will assess the advanced cyber capabilities of emerging AI models and establish the exact technical threshold that designates a system as a "covered frontier model." By defining this threshold, the government aims to separate routine commercial AI applications from highly capable systems that could pose national security risks.[3][4]
The administration has explicitly disclaimed any intention to create a mandatory licensing, preclearance, or permitting requirement for AI development. This marks a sharp departure from earlier proposals and international approaches, such as the European Union's AI Act, which impose heavy compliance burdens on developers. Instead, the US framework is designed to remove bureaucratic barriers, signaling a lighter-touch federal posture that favors speed and open-source development.[2]
The argument for this voluntary, innovation-first approach centers on the realities of the global technology race. Proponents argue that overly burdensome regulations would stifle American ingenuity, driving top talent and capital to competing nations. By keeping compliance voluntary, the US ensures that its domestic AI ecosystem can iterate rapidly, maintaining a crucial competitive edge in both commercial markets and military applications.[3]
The evidence supporting this deregulatory stance points to the rapid, unhindered growth of the American AI sector, which currently leads the world in private-sector investment and infrastructure deployment. Furthermore, leading AI developers like Anthropic and OpenAI have already demonstrated a willingness to voluntarily submit their models for government testing, suggesting that the industry is capable of self-policing when national security is on the line.[1][2]
The case against the voluntary framework highlights the inherent risks of relying on corporate goodwill to protect critical infrastructure. Critics argue that without mandatory enforcement mechanisms, the government has no legal authority to stop a company from releasing a dangerous model if it chooses to bypass the 30-day review window. This leaves a potential blind spot for rogue developers or highly capable open-source models that are distributed without any federal oversight.[4]

The evidence for a more stringent, mandatory approach is rooted in the escalating capabilities of modern AI systems. Recent models have demonstrated a notable ability to identify and exploit high-severity software vulnerabilities, write malicious code, and automate cyberattacks. Security advocates point out that as these systems become more autonomous, the potential for catastrophic damage to banking systems, hospitals, and emergency services far outweighs the economic benefits of unregulated speed.[1]
This policy debate forces a direct trade-off between the speed of technological deployment and the assurance of comprehensive safety guarantees. On one side is a multi-hundred-billion-dollar AI economy that thrives on rapid iteration; on the other is the unquantifiable risk of an AI-enabled cyberattack crippling national infrastructure. The executive order attempts to thread this needle by treating AI as both a strategic asset to be cultivated and an emerging attack vector to be managed.[3]
To mitigate the risks of the voluntary approach, the administration launched the "Gold Eagle" initiative in mid-July 2026. Led by the Treasury Department, this federal-industry clearinghouse coordinates software-vulnerability scanning and accelerates patch distribution across federal systems and critical infrastructure. By using proprietary frontier models defensively, the government hopes to outpace malicious actors in discovering and fixing zero-day vulnerabilities.
Ultimately, this light-touch, voluntary model fits well when the leading AI laboratories share a vested interest in national security and are willing to cooperate to prevent catastrophic public relations and security failures. It thrives in an environment where the primary developers are established, US-based corporations that rely on government contracts and public trust, making them naturally inclined to participate in the 30-day review process.[2][4]

However, this framework does not fit well when dealing with decentralized, open-weight models that can be modified and deployed by anonymous actors outside of US jurisdiction. It also struggles in scenarios where intense commercial pressures force companies into a race to the bottom on safety, prioritizing immediate market share over the thorough, time-consuming security testing required to protect critical infrastructure.[1]
The executive order also directs the Attorney General to prioritize criminal enforcement against anyone who utilizes AI to illegally access or damage a computer system. By focusing on the malicious use of the technology rather than regulating its creation, the government is attempting to deter cybercrime without penalizing the underlying innovation.[4]
As the global tech race accelerates, the US has clearly signaled its strategy: out-innovate adversaries while building robust, AI-enabled cyber defenses. Whether this voluntary framework can adequately protect the nation from the very technology it seeks to promote will depend entirely on the ongoing cooperation between the White House and Silicon Valley's most powerful developers.[3]
How we got here
July 2025
The White House releases America's AI Action Plan, focusing on accelerating innovation and building AI infrastructure.
December 2025
Executive Order 14365 is signed to establish a national policy framework and challenge state-level AI regulations.
June 2, 2026
Executive Order 14409 is issued, establishing the voluntary 30-day review window for frontier AI models.
July 14, 2026
The Treasury Department launches the 'Gold Eagle' initiative to coordinate AI-enabled vulnerability scanning across federal systems.

Key terms
- Frontier Model
- The most advanced and capable artificial intelligence systems currently in development, often possessing capabilities that exceed standard commercial applications.
- Zero-day Vulnerability
- A software flaw that is unknown to the vendor or developers, meaning there is zero days of notice to fix it before it can be exploited by hackers.
- Benchmarking
- The process of running standardized tests on an AI model to evaluate its capabilities, such as its ability to write malicious code or defend against cyberattacks.
- Clearinghouse
- A central agency or organization responsible for collecting, classifying, and distributing information—in this case, data regarding AI-enabled cybersecurity threats.
